Autodesk inventor, creo parametric, and solidworks. You can integrate hydraulic, electrical, pneumatic, and other physical systems into your model using components. A production system with a robotic pickandplace mechanism shows how simulation can help engineers select motors and drives, design control logic, and optimize robotic trajectories. This matlab function returns the probability density function pdf for the oneparameter distribution family specified by name and the distribution parameter a. This matlab function returns the probability density function pdf of the standard gamma distribution with the shape parameter a, evaluated at the values in x. Frame centered in the first generation, all rigid body coordinate systems are defined in the body block, using a dialog.
Simulink creates one file for all of the systems in the model. So this is what i did to get it solved and hope this helps for who runs into the same problem. Simscape multibody formerly simmechanics provides a multibody simulation environment for 3d mechanical systems, such as robots, vehicle suspensions, construction equipment, and aircraft landing gear. You can export an assembly model from onshape cad software using the smexportonshape function.
Applications and tasks in simscape multibody matlab. A kernel distribution is a nonparametric representation of the probability density function pdf of a random variable. Scripts share local variables with functions they call and with the base workspace. The plugin is compatible with three cad applications. Learn how to use simscape multibody to solve your technical challenge by exploring model examples. It contains a library of blocks for use with simscape multibody that detect collision between various shapes. Simmechanics second generation simmechanics second generation is a complete redesign of simmechanics. Choose a web site to get translated content where available and see local events and offers.
In addition to softwareintheloop sil and processorintheloop pil tests, converting your simscape multibody models to c code lets you run hardwareintheloop hil tests. Enable simscape multibody link solidworks plugin matlab. Hello, i use both matlab and simmechanics to do simulations and compare if they are the same. You can model multibody systems using blocks representing bodies, joints, constraints, force elements, and sensors. Simscape multibody helps you develop control systems and test systemlevel performance. However, as the definition shows, the difference is that in simmechanics the systems simulated are mechanical systems. In matlab r2009b you can now publish your matlab code directly to a pdf file. Follow 2 views last 30 days chihheng on 10 oct 2011.
Most members of the stable distribution family do not have an explicit probability density function pdf. The matlab variables you use to set parameters for your model can be automatically tuned to meet design requirements, or tested throughout a given range to see their effect on system performance. The first three tutorials are selected from the matlab simulink help. Persistent persistent r, c can be declared and used only in functions.
However, for 2d and 3d problems or if the friction force depends on the normal force, i recommend looking at the file exchange submission simscape multibody contact forces library. Applications and tasks in simscape multibody video. Simscape multibody previously simmechanics offers a multibody simulation environment for 3d mechanical systems, such as robotics, automobile suspensions, building and construction devices, and airplane landing equipment. The simscape multibody link plugin provides the primary interface for exporting cad assemblies into simscape multibody software. The fourth example is a simple simmechanics example which can help you learn the simmechanics more. This matlab function returns the probability density function pdf for the one parameter distribution family specified by name and the distribution parameter a. I noticed that the ode solver for matlab and simmechanics are not exactly the same, which causes some differences on the results. Normal probability density function matlab normpdf mathworks. The smnew function opens a simscape multibody model template with commonly used blocks and variablestep automatic solver selection for best performance. Mar 03, 2016 simscape multibody models integrate directly with block diagrams in simulink, state machines in stateflow, and matlab functions. You clicked a link that corresponds to this matlab command. Multibody simulation with simscape multibody video.
This accelerates tasks such as designing control systems and optimizing systemlevel performance. Oct 10, 2011 matlab and simmechanics ode functions. Browse the library to select blocks for your model. Well now you can go to pdf directly, and get a higher quality document than you would by going through word and then to pdf. Global global speedoflight shared by functions, scripts, and base workspace. This enables you to test embedded controllers without endangering equipment and. Enable simscape multibody link solidworks plugin about the plugin. I developed a model of lhd in matlab and i want to run it in simulation using simmechanics. Simscape multibody enables the user to explore 3d mechanical models, including replaying animations of simulation results. July 2002 fifth printing revised for simulink 5 release april 2003 online only revised for simulink 5.
You can simulate your entire system in a single environment. Feb 05, 2020 i developed a model of lhd in matlab and i want to run it in simulation using simmechanics. Simmechanics second generation guy on simulink matlab. Multibody simulation with simscape multibody view more related videos. You can also use the following generic functions to work with most of the distributions. This matlab function returns the probability density function pdf of the standard normal distribution, evaluated at the values in x. Follow 1 views last 30 days mohamed trabia on 6 jan 2012. Modeling of dynamic systems in simulation environment.
Importing and merging cad models into simmechanics 47. I dont know what caused yours but my problem was i installed 3 version of matlab and all have simmechanics installed on. Using main simscape functions the purpose of main simscape functions is to reuse expressions in equations of multiple components, as well as in member declarations of domain or component files. Use this function to access simscape multibody blocks without having to wait for the simulink and simscape. Simmechanics users, the first time you opened the simulink library browser in r2012a, you probably noticed a big change.
You can design multibody systems utilizing blocks representing bodies, joints, restrictions, force. Gamma probability density function matlab gampdf mathworks. Block diagrams in simmechanics are direct representations of physical components e. Simmechanics link exports critical data and mate information to a file that can be imported by simmechanics. Simscape multibody models enable you to test embedded control algorithms and controller hardware without using hardware prototypes. Pdf modeling of dynamic systems in simulation enviroment. Simmechanics link problem matlab answers matlab central. It can b e used while building the mo del as a guide in the assembly pro cess. If a matlab function and a simscape function have the same name, the matlab function has higher precedence. For 1d contact problems where only viscous friction is present, the hardstop block may be sufficient. Matlab directly uses functions for numerical solution of differential equations. You can design multibody systems utilizing blocks representing bodies, joints, restrictions, force components. Get started with simscape multibody mathworks france. Run the command by entering it in the matlab command window.
Simscape multibody is used in a wide range of applications. Simscape multibody provides a multibody simulation environment for 3d mechanical systems, such as robots, vehicle suspensions, construction equipment, and aircraft landing gear. You can find more detailed information in the software help. The pdf values are the same as those computed using the probability distribution object. You can parameterize your models using matlab variables and expressions, and design control systems for your multibody system in simulink.
A 3d visualization of a robotic arm is used to show options of exploring simscape multibody models. Based on your location, we recommend that you select. This function generates the same files as the simscape multibody link pluginone an xml multibody description file, the rest a set of body geometry files if you use a different cad application, you can create a custom application based on the published. Combining simscape multibody models with simscape components and control systems modeled in simulink makes it possible to simulate and analyze your. You can enhance the visualization using all standard matlabgraphics functions. The first three tutorials are selected from the matlab.
1364 1151 1512 709 1262 1131 1099 283 1353 442 417 1086 1455 1123 1582 563 1659 20 339 226 309 1034 1658 1469 728 619 993 1102 204 1117 889 1483 119